Transaction 5bc94bff145b7960ce50ba2eb8b2ca22256c8b1e69950b7b67ddde0a4cf45215
1 Input
1 Output
-
5bc94bff145b7960ce50ba2eb8b2ca22256c8b1e69950b7b67ddde0a4cf45215:0
- value
- 626517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50b492662766996a97c6f4a224176c287c667fb1 OP_EQUAL
- address
- 393kJF6ExNDcopLkhAbQUaRJGYPs3jmP2y